Creating Intelligent Chatbots: A Step-by-Step Approach

Deploying advanced chatbots requires a methodical method. This involves several important steps, starting with defining the chatbot's purpose and limitations. Next, you need to collect data to train your chatbot. This dataset should be extensive and applicable to the chatbot's domain.

Additionally, you'll need to opt for a suitable tool for chatbot construction. Popular choices include Dialogflow.

Afterward, integrate the chosen framework's capabilities to construct your chatbot's logic. Don't forget to assess your chatbot thoroughly throughout the development process to guarantee its accuracy. Finally, release your chatbot and regularly track its output to identify areas for enhancement.

Ethical Considerations in AI Chatbot Development

Developing AI chatbots presents a plethora with ethical dilemmas that engineers must thoroughly consider. , To begin with, chatbots can perpetuate existing biases present in the data they are trained on, leading to unfair outcomes. It is crucial to address these biases through careful data selection and development. Furthermore, ensuring user security is paramount, as chatbots may collect sensitive data during conversations.

  • Openness in chatbot functionality is also crucial. Users should be informed that they are interacting with an AI, and the scope of the chatbot's competencies should be clearly stated.
  • , Ultimately, the development and deployment of AI chatbots necessitate ongoing evaluation to uncover potential ethical concerns and implement corrective measures.

Safeguarding User Information in Chatbots

As chatbots rise in usage, safeguarding sensitive user data is paramount. These AI-powered platforms often handle personal information, such as names, addresses, and financial details. Implementing robust security measures is crucial to prevent malicious actors from exploiting vulnerabilities.

    Utilize strong encryption algorithms to protect data both in transit and at rest.
  • Conduct periodic security assessments to identify potential weaknesses.
  • Provide clear guidelines on what data is collected and how it is used
